Output 6618c244fe25dda250f194af79964453d73fd7f56703dcb7b53d8ca7cc2d6f56:12

value
4653089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5da6cfb9d2a65ee3c3dda140b50a387d3644e439 OP_EQUAL
address
3AECbeNxDuoUQagYfAkJHyfCTcgAhnNMod
transaction
6618c244fe25dda250f194af79964453d73fd7f56703dcb7b53d8ca7cc2d6f56
spent
true